Entertainment and Image Comics, in partnership with Universal Products & Experiences, have announced they will be reissuing its Universal Monsters: Dracula series as two black-and-white specials by The Department of Truth co-creators, writer James Tynion IV and artist Martin Simmonds.

“The first installment plunges readers into the eerie world of Dr. John Seward’s asylum, where a new patient arrives whispering about a demon who has taken residence next door. As Dr. Seward struggles to apply logic to the madness, his surrogate daughter Lucy begins to fall under the dark influence of the twisted Count Dracula!”
Of course, the angle for this black and white repackaging is to mimic the silver age of cinema in which Dracula was originally released by Universal Studios in black-and-white. Not just another cash grab, of course. Something I would be more than willing to believe if it wasn’t for the fact they are taking fully painted pages and washing the colour out. These aren’t your usual pen and ink pages that would work well in black-and-white, like many Artist’s Editions out there. But this … I’m not sure.
But, there will be a market for it. So for those fans, you’ll need to know that Universal Monsters: Dracula Black & White Special #1 is out on Wednesday, October 29th, 2025 and Universal Monsters: Dracula Black & White Special #2, is out on Wednesday, November 26th, 2025.
